package org.apache.doris.nereids.trees.expressions.functions.executable;

import org.apache.doris.nereids.trees.expressions.ExecFunction;
import org.apache.doris.nereids.trees.expressions.Expression;
import org.apache.doris.nereids.trees.expressions.literal.DateLiteral;
import org.apache.doris.nereids.trees.expressions.literal.DateTimeLiteral;
import org.apache.doris.nereids.trees.expressions.literal.DateTimeV2Literal;
import org.apache.doris.nereids.trees.expressions.literal.DateV2Literal;
import org.apache.doris.nereids.trees.expressions.literal.IntegerLiteral;

import java.time.LocalDateTime;
import java.time.temporal.ChronoUnit;

/**
 * executable function: date_add/sub, years/quarters/months/week/days/hours/minutes/seconds_add/sub, datediff
 */
public class DateTimeArithmetic {
    /**
     * datetime arithmetic function date-add.
     */
    @ExecFunction(name = "date_add")
    public static Expression dateAdd(DateLiteral date, IntegerLiteral day) {
        return daysAdd(date, day);
    }

    @ExecFunction(name = "date_add")
    public static Expression dateAdd(DateTimeLiteral date, IntegerLiteral day) {
        return daysAdd(date, day);
    }

    @ExecFunction(name = "date_add")
    public static Expression dateAdd(DateV2Literal date, IntegerLiteral day) {
        return daysAdd(date, day);
    }

    @ExecFunction(name = "date_add")
    public static Expression dateAdd(DateTimeV2Literal date, IntegerLiteral day) {
        return daysAdd(date, day);
    }

    /**
     * datetime arithmetic function date-sub.
     */
    @ExecFunction(name = "date_sub")
    public static Expression dateSub(DateLiteral date, IntegerLiteral day) {
        return dateAdd(date, new IntegerLiteral(-day.getValue()));
    }

    @ExecFunction(name = "date_sub")
    public static Expression dateSub(DateTimeLiteral date, IntegerLiteral day) {
        return dateAdd(date, new IntegerLiteral(-day.getValue()));
    }

    @ExecFunction(name = "date_sub")
    public static Expression dateSub(DateV2Literal date, IntegerLiteral day) {
        return dateAdd(date, new IntegerLiteral(-day.getValue()));
    }

    @ExecFunction(name = "date_sub")
    public static Expression dateSub(DateTimeV2Literal date, IntegerLiteral day) {
        return dateAdd(date, new IntegerLiteral(-day.getValue()));
    }

    /**
     * datetime arithmetic function datediff
     */
    @ExecFunction(name = "datediff")
    public static Expression dateDiff(DateTimeLiteral date1, DateTimeLiteral date2) {
        return new IntegerLiteral(dateDiff(date1.toJavaDateType(), date2.toJavaDateType()));
    }

    @ExecFunction(name = "datediff")
    public static Expression dateDiff(DateV2Literal date1, DateV2Literal date2) {
        return new IntegerLiteral(dateDiff(date1.toJavaDateType(), date2.toJavaDateType()));
    }

    @ExecFunction(name = "datediff")
    public static Expression dateDiff(DateV2Literal date1, DateTimeV2Literal date2) {
        return new IntegerLiteral(dateDiff(date1.toJavaDateType(), date2.toJavaDateType()));
    }

    @ExecFunction(name = "datediff")
    public static Expression dateDiff(DateTimeV2Literal date1, DateV2Literal date2) {
        return new IntegerLiteral(dateDiff(date1.toJavaDateType(), date2.toJavaDateType()));
    }

    @ExecFunction(name = "datediff")
    public static Expression dateDiff(DateTimeV2Literal date1, DateTimeV2Literal date2) {
        return new IntegerLiteral(dateDiff(date1.toJavaDateType(), date2.toJavaDateType()));
    }

    private static int dateDiff(LocalDateTime date1, LocalDateTime date2) {
        return ((int) ChronoUnit.DAYS.between(date2.toLocalDate(), date1.toLocalDate()));
    }

    @ExecFunction(name = "to_days")
    public static Expression toDays(DateLiteral date) {
        return new IntegerLiteral((int) date.getDay());
    }

    @ExecFunction(name = "to_days")
    public static Expression toDays(DateV2Literal date) {
        return new IntegerLiteral((int) date.getDay());
    }
}
